Name:Worth Gate

Summary

Town gate of Roman origin, mainly destroyed in the 18th century, partly incorporated into adjacent buildings

[TR 14555739] Worthgate [NR] (Site of) [NAT]. (1) Regarded as of Roman origin, destroyed 1791. (2) 28 Castle Street. Grade II. Dated 1730, the building, originally the Old Kent Sessions House, incorporates part of the Roman Worthgate and City Wall. (3) The south-east side of Worth Gate, 15ft wide and the floor of a probable guard-chamber were discovered in 1961 when deep trenching for a gas-main along the south-east side of Castle Street. (4-5) In c1548 the Worth Gate was blocked, but traces of a Roman arch survive in Stukeley's drawing of c1724. In c1791 the gateway was re-opened but the old arch removed. (5)
